How to Find an Online Tutoring Job

Are you interested in working as an online tutor and making money from the comfort of your own home? Finding an online tutoring job is easier than you might think.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get started:

1. Register with a Tutoring Platform or Website

To begin your journey as an online tutor, start by registering with a reputable tutoring platform or website. Some popular platforms include Skooli, TutorMe, Tutor.com, and Chegg. These platforms connect you with potential clients and provide valuable resources to enhance your tutoring skills.

2. Complete Additional Testing or Assessments

Many tutoring platforms require you to undergo additional testing or assessments to ensure that you meet their qualifications. These assessments may evaluate your subject knowledge, teaching skills, or proficiency in a specific area. Take these tests seriously to showcase your expertise to potential clients.

3. Create an Attractive Profile

Your profile is your chance to make a strong impression on potential clients. Highlight your qualifications, teaching experience, and subject expertise. Use an engaging and professional tone to convey your passion for teaching and your commitment to helping students succeed.

4. Upload a Video Greeting

A video greeting can add a personal touch to your profile and give potential clients a glimpse of your teaching style. Record a short video introducing yourself, discussing your teaching methods, and expressing your enthusiasm for tutoring. This will help you stand out from other tutors and create a connection with prospective students.

5. Start Receiving Tutoring Requests

Once your profile is complete, you can start receiving tutoring requests. These requests may come directly from the tutoring platform or through messages from potential clients. Respond promptly and professionally to each inquiry to demonstrate your commitment and willingness to help students.

6. Hold Your First Tutoring Session

After accepting a tutoring request, schedule your first session with the student. Prepare materials, lesson plans, or practice exercises to ensure a productive and engaging session. Make sure to create a comfortable and supportive learning environment that promotes student success.

7. Build Your Reputation

As you hold more tutoring sessions and receive positive feedback from students, your reputation as an online tutor will grow. This will lead to more requests for your tutoring services and potentially higher-paying opportunities. Always strive to provide high-quality instruction and excellent customer service to cultivate a positive reputation in the online tutoring community.

By following these steps, you can find an online tutoring job and embark on an exciting journey of helping students succeed while earning money from the comfort of your own home.

How Much Should I Charge for Tutoring?

When it comes to setting your tutoring rates, several factors come into play. Your qualifications, expertise, and the market demand for your subject all contribute to determining the amount you should charge for your tutoring services. Here are a few steps to help you arrive at a fair and competitive rate:

  1. Research local rates: Start by researching the tutoring rates in your area. Take into account the average rates charged by other tutors who offer similar services and cater to the same target audience. This will give you a baseline to work from and ensure that your rates are competitive.
  2. Evaluate your qualifications: Consider your qualifications and experience in the subject you plan to teach. If you hold advanced degrees or have extensive expertise in a particular field, you may be able to charge higher rates compared to tutors with less experience or lower credentials.
  3. Assess your teaching experience: Take into account your teaching experience when determining your rates. If you have many years of experience as a tutor or classroom teacher, you can justify charging higher rates based on your proven track record of success.
  4. Consider the demand: Evaluate the demand for your tutoring services. If you offer a highly sought-after subject or specialize in helping students with specific exams or test prep, you may be able to charge a premium for your expertise.
  5. Adjust rates as you gain experience: As you gain experience and build a reputation as a tutor, you can gradually increase your rates. Happy clients and positive testimonials can provide a solid foundation for justifying higher fees.

What Is the Best Platform for Online Tutoring?

When it comes to online tutoring, finding the right platform is crucial for success. There are several popular platforms available, each offering unique features and opportunities for tutors. As an experienced tutor, I can recommend some of the top platforms that have proven to be effective for tutoring services online.

Popular Online Tutoring Platforms

  • Skooli: This platform offers live one-on-one tutoring sessions with a focus on personalized learning.
  • TutorMe: TutorMe provides on-demand tutoring in various subjects, allowing tutors to reach students quickly.
  • Tutor.com: With a wide range of subjects and flexible scheduling, Tutor.com is a popular choice for both students and tutors.
  • Yup: Yup specializes in math and science tutoring, offering 24/7 support for students.
  • VIPKid: VIPKid focuses on teaching English to students in China, offering flexible hours and competitive pay.
  • Chegg: Chegg provides tutoring in multiple subjects and also offers opportunities for textbook solutions and online courses.
  • Smarthinking: Smarthinking offers tutoring services across various subjects, including writing assistance.
  • Wyzant: Wyzant allows tutors to set their own rates and schedules, giving them more control over their tutoring business.
  • Varsity Tutors: Varsity Tutors offers both in-person and online tutoring options, covering a wide range of subjects.
  • Brainfuse: Brainfuse provides live tutoring services in various subjects and also offers help with resume writing and job searches.
  • GeeklyHub: GeeklyHub focuses on coding and computer science tutoring, catering to students with a passion for technology.
  • Revolution Prep: Revolution Prep specializes in test preparation, helping students excel in standardized exams like the SAT and ACT.

These platforms have established a strong reputation within the online tutoring community and offer a wide range of subjects and flexible scheduling options.
